Following up on JediNews’ reveal of the Digital Release Commemorative Collection sets, Andrew’s Toyz has posted via Facebook new loose and boxed images of these packs. Some of the details have changed since first announced as Padmé is now included in the Episode I set (previously thought to include Obi-Wan). Look for release information and pricing to be announced next week at NY Toy Fair.

Thanks to Facebook follower Scott G. we can report that Star Wars Rebels Imperial Troop Transport has started to hit ToysRUs. Scott found his in Detroit, MI for only $10.99! Lots of Rebels goodies hitting stores lately so time to make a run!
Entertainment Earth has updated with some new Funko Fabrikations figures today and amongst the listings is Dark Lord of the Plush – Darth Vader. Like other Fabrikations figures, it features a rotating head and stands over 6″ tall.

Idle Hands has posted an article and gallery of Hasbro’s Marvel product slated to be showcased at Toy Fair 2015 next week. Within the items is a new line of figures similar to Titan Heroes but in a smaller 6″ scale – with only 3-4 POA. Read on for what this may mean for the Star Wars brand.
